[DRE-maint] Bug#631849: rubygems: Undefined method `skip_during' for Deprecated:Module
Ken Bloom
kbloom at gmail.com
Mon Jun 27 18:41:21 UTC 2011
Package: rubygems
Version: 1.7.2-1
Severity: critical
When I try to load various gems, I get the error "Undefined method
`skip_during' for Deprecated:Module". This occurs even if the gem
doesn't exist.
(Also, can you do something to get rid of the "warning: already
initialized constant Deprecate")
[bloom at cat-in-the-hat ~]$ irb
irb(main):001:0> require 'rubygems'
=> true
irb(main):002:0> require 'dbi'
/usr/lib/ruby/1.8/deprecated.rb:199: warning: already initialized constant Deprecate
NoMethodError: undefined method `skip_during' for Deprecated:Module
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:126: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`reverse_each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:321:in `refresh!'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:97:in `initialize'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`new'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`source_index'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:243:in `activate_dep'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:236:in `activate'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1307:in `gem'
from /usr/lib/ruby/1.8/dbi/columninfo.rb:5
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:36:in `gem_original_require'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:36:in `require'
from /usr/lib/ruby/1.8/dbi.rb:46
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:36:in `gem_original_require'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:36:in `require'
from (irb):2
irb(main):003:0> require 'facets'
NoMethodError: undefined method `skip_during' for Deprecated:Module
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:126: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`reverse_each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:321:in `refresh!'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:97:in `initialize'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`new'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`source_index'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/gem_path_searcher.rb:135:in `init_gemspecs'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/gem_path_searcher.rb:14:in `initialize'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1010:in `new'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1010:in `searcher'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:207:in `try_activate'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:56:in `require'
from (irb):3
from /usr/lib/ruby/1.8/x86_64-linux/rbconfig.rb:53irb(main):004:0>
irb(main):005:0* require 'foo'
NoMethodError: undefined method `skip_during' for Deprecated:Module
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:126: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:125: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`reverse_each'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:122:in `load_gems_in'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:321:in `refresh!'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/source_index.rb:97:in `initialize'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`new'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1051:in `source_index'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/gem_path_searcher.rb:135:in `init_gemspecs'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/gem_path_searcher.rb:14:in `initialize'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1010:in `new'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:1010:in `searcher'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ems.rb:207:in `try_activate'
from /usr/lib/ruby/vendor_ruby/1.8/rubygems/custom_require.rb:56:in `require'
from (irb):5
from /usr/lib/ruby/1.8/x86_64-linux/rbconfig.rb:53irb(main):006:0>
-- System Information:
Debian Release: wheezy/sid
APT prefers unstable
APT policy: (500, 'unstable'), (1, 'experimental')
Architecture: amd64 (x86_64)
Kernel: Linux 2.6.39-2-amd64 (SMP w/2 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Versions of packages rubygems depends on:
ii ruby1.8 1.8.7.334-5 Interpreter of object-oriented scr
Versions of packages rubygems recommends:
ii build-essential 11.5 Informational list of build-essent
ii ruby1.8-dev 1.8.7.334-5 Header files for compiling extensi
rubygems suggests no packages.
-- no debconf information
More information about the Pkg-ruby-extras-maintainers
mailing list